

This political novel in which a Russian revolutionary cell's aim is to overthrow the Tsar, destroy society and seize power. They train terrorists who are willing to go to any lengths to achieve their goals - even if the mission means suicide. But when it seems that the group is about to be discovered, will their recruits be willing to kill one of their own circle in order to cover their tracks?
Demons by Mehmet Izbudak
Directed by Mehmet Izbudak
Tuesday 17th - Saturday 21st November 2012
Studio at New Wimbledon Theatre
